American doctors say that mothers who smoke cigarettes before their babies are born may slow the growth of their babies’ lungs.They say reduced lung growth could cause the babies to suffer breathing problems and lung disease later in life.Doctors in Boston,Massachusetts studied 1,100 children.The mothers of some of the children smoked and the other mothers did not.Doctors found that the lungs of the children whose mothers smoked were 8% less developed than the lungs of the children whose mothers did not smoke,and that the children whose mothers smoked developed 20% more cold and breathing diseases than other children later in life.
Another recent study found that children had a greater chance of developing lung cancer if their mothers smoked.The study also showed that the danger of lung cancer increased only for sons and not for daughters,and that the father’s smoking did not affect a child’s chance of developing lung cancer.

“Sam’s Journey” is the main attraction of an exhibition to be staged at Bugis+ shopping mall.The show,organized by five Singaporean college students,will start the yearly Anti-Drug Abuse Campaign(反毒品滥用运动) of this year.Besides the main attraction,there are many kinds of anti-drug games for people to play.
“Sam’s Journey” takes visitors through a maze(迷宫) of activities and information that lets them experience how “Sam’s” life was destroyed by drug abuse.
The maze starts with how“Sam”first started using drugs and became heavily dependent on them.In the middle of the maze,visitors get to wear a specially-designed pair of glasses trying to copy what it is like to be under the influence of drugs.Then visitors go through a dark room with lights flashing(闪烁) that give them an experience similar to the side effects of using drugs.
“Sam’s” life goes further downhill once police officers catch him.Visitors get to experience what it is like in prison as one of the maze checkpoints is a prison cell(a small room built for prisoners).
“We did not want to feed information through experts.We wanted people to walk through this maze to learn about drug abuse and its bad influences,”said Mr Jenson Seah,one of the five Singaporean students.
As the student organizers hope visitors will learn valuable lessons from the show,they too realize that putting the event together was an enriching(丰富的) experience.
“By working with officers from the National Council Against Drug Abuse,I learned a lot about drug abuse and it stretched(延伸) beyond my degree course learning experience,”said Mr Seah.
The show,which will be given from June 21-22,is just the first of a series of events for the yearly Anti-Drug Abuse Campaign.The two-month-long campaign will include an online photography competition and an Anti-Drug School Corner Competition.

During adolescence(青春期),peers(同龄人)play a large part in a young person’s life and typically replace family as the centre of a teen’s social activities.Some kids give in to peer pressure because they want to be liked or because they worry that other kids may make fun of them if they don’t go along with the group.Others may go along because they are curious to try something new that others are doing.The idea that “everyone’s doing it” may influence some kids to leave their better judgment,or their common sense,behind.
As children grow,develop and move into early adolescence,contacts with one’s peers and the attraction of peer identification(认同)increase.As pre-adolescents begin rapid physical,emotional and social changes,they begin to question adult standards and the need for parental guidance.They find it good to turn for advice to friends who understand—friends who are in the same position themselves.By trying new things and testing their ideas with their peers,there is less fear of being laughed at.
There are two levels of peer pressure.The first is in the large group:for most teens a school or a youth group are examples.This is the situation that gets the most attention.The second is in the close relationship with one or several best friends.This is the situation that is sometimes disregarded.The large group puts a general pressure on its members.It sets the standard for clothing,music,entertainment,and“political correctness”.The pressure can be avoided by keeping quiet or by putting on the appearance of agreement.

含义:感动123452)辨析:affect,effect和influence
affect指“产生的影响之大足以引起反应”,着重“影响”的动作,有时含有“对……产生不利影响”之意。
effect作动词时,指“使(某事物)产生,使发生,引起”,着重“造成”一种特殊的效果;作“影响”解时,通常用作名词,构成have an effect on“对……有影响”。
influence指“通过说服、举例等对行动、思想、性格等产生不易觉察到的、潜移默化的影响”。12345④This news didn’t affect her at all.

Should electronic cigarettes be a new choice for smokers trying to kick the habit?Opinions from Americans are different.
More than half of the people questioned in a survey think electronic cigarettes should be controlled by the US Food and Drug Administration,but 47 percent believe they should be allowed to be sold to those smokers who want to quit.
“In the search for a safer cigarette,electronic cigarettes,often referred to as e-cigarettes,are becoming popular among those either trying to quit or who are looking to replace standard tobacco smoke with something that producers think to be safer,” Zogby International,which made the survey,said in a statement.
About half of the 4,611 adults who took part in the survey had heard about e-cigarettes,which are battery-powered devices that turn liquid nicotine into gas.They do not produce smoke but an odorless(not smelly)water vapour.
Last year the WHO warned against using e-cigarettes,saying there was no evidence to prove they were safe or help smokers break the habit.The WHO said people who smoke e-cigarettes breathe the same amount of nicotine into the lungs.
Nearly a third of the people questioned in the survey think that e-cigarettes,because they don’t produce smoke,should be allowed in places where smoking is not allowed,but 46 percent disagree.Men who know about e-cigarettes are more likely than women to say the smokers who want to quit should be allowed to enjoy them.Young people,aged 18-29,and singles are the groups most open to trying e-cigarettes.
Tobacco is the largest cause of preventable death worldwide,according to the WHO.
